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 942419467 3323 9660
7369 509
7369 509
35300105 2733 55
All about undefined
Interested in learning more?
7369 509
35300105 2733 55
See more
5150220 55718214450
187 2783664866 687088995 373 099301
See more
830857 04594667 92695
09096 562 466301
See more